Wiktionary
FINLAND, proper noun. One of the Nordic countries having borders with Sweden, Norway and Russia. Member state of the European Union since 1995. Official name: Republic of Finland (Suomen tasavalta in Finnish, Republiken Finland in Swedish).
Dictionary definition
FINLAND, noun. Republic in northern Europe; achieved independence from Russia in 1917.
